umm when you changed diff. fluid did you add the friction modifier to the fluid. or your trac. loc. could be wore out and really is a simple fix, its like 50 bucks for clutch pack rebuild kit from summit, or a local ford dealership, and takes a couple hours with minimal tools realy it took me like 1.5 hours so go for it

I agree with the plus 1 mod.. Also take it easy on the friction modifier, this stuff loosens the action of the limited slip so it won't chatter around turns. I like to use as little as needed to get low speed chatter to stop.
